Viking Therapeutics, Inc. (Nasdaq:VKTX), a pioneering cl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company focused on developing innovative therapies for metabolic and endocrine disorders, is thrilled to announce the successful closing of a $24 million funding round. This significant investment will bolster the advancement of Viking鈥檚 promising research pipeline and enhance its ability to bring groundbreaking therapies to market. Currently, the company is making strides in clinical development with its lead candidate, a non-steroidal selective androgen receptor modulator (SARM), which is undergoing a Phase 2 trial aimed at enhancing recovery outcomes for patients following hip fracture surgery. Additionally, Viking is advancing its thyroid receptor beta (TRb) agonist platform, which is also in Phase 2 trials, targeting lipid disorders such as hypercholesterolemia and critical liver diseases, including non-alc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H). The funding will not only support these key therapeutic candidates but will also facilitate exploration into rare diseases like glycogen storage disease (GSD 1a) and X-linked adrenoleukodystrophy (X-ALD).
